NEOSEP™ Immersed Membrane Bioreactor
Our new generation membrane bioreactor combines enhanced biological treatment using activated sludge with immersed membrane filtration to produce superior effluent quality.
The compact design results in a very small footprint for full-scale systems. The pilot treatment unit processes 2 GPM and establishes pretreatment requirements and performance results.

ACTIFLO® / MULTIFLO™ Softening Technology
Our pilot unit for high rate softening technology has the capability of testing both ACTIFLO® and MULTIFLO™ softening processes to determine which best fits your application.
Both technologies offer high rate softening within a small footprint.
- Operating in ACTIFLO® Softening mode, the pilot unit processes up to 130 GPM combining chemical precipitation with recirculated microsand, which acts as a seed for floc formation.
- Operating in MULTIFLO™ Softening mode, the pilot unit treats up to 40 GPM and incorporates chemical precipitation with sludge thickening, producing a highly concentrated sludge that can easily be dewatered.

OPUS™ technology is ideal for treatment of produced water from oil and gas exploration and production activities, or other industrial waste streams where zero discharge is desired.
OPUS™ technology utilizes a reverse osmosis process operated at an elevated pH to produce a high quality effluent suitable for recycle or reuse while generating low waste volume.The high water recovery rate is accomplished in either a single-pass or double-pass configuration, reducing total dissolved solids, silica, boron, and organics present in the feed water.
The technology involves degasification, MULTIFLO™ chemical softening, multimedia filtration, ion exchange, and cartridge filtration as pretreatment to the RO membranes.The entire process consists of a pilot treatment trailer and two skids that can be brought to your doorstep for testing your waste streams.The mobile unit processes up to 20 gpm.

ZDD - Zero Discharge Desalination
Zero Discharge Desalination (ZDD) is a desalination technology that achieves higher water recovery that any other available alternative. The technology is ideal for inland brackish groundwater treatment, retrofitting existing RO systems, and plant capacity expansion as end-of-pipe add-on.
